Home
last modified time | relevance | path

Searched refs:msa (Results 1 – 16 of 16) sorted by relevance

/linux-6.1.9/arch/mips/kernel/
Dsignal.c164 struct msa_extcontext __user *msa = buf; in save_msa_extcontext() local
187 err = __put_user(read_msa_csr(), &msa->csr); in save_msa_extcontext()
188 err |= _save_msa_all_upper(&msa->wr); in save_msa_extcontext()
194 err = __put_user(current->thread.fpu.msacsr, &msa->csr); in save_msa_extcontext()
198 err |= __put_user(val, &msa->wr[i]); in save_msa_extcontext()
202 err |= __put_user(MSA_EXTCONTEXT_MAGIC, &msa->ext.magic); in save_msa_extcontext()
203 err |= __put_user(sizeof(*msa), &msa->ext.size); in save_msa_extcontext()
205 return err ? -EFAULT : sizeof(*msa); in save_msa_extcontext()
210 struct msa_extcontext __user *msa = buf; in restore_msa_extcontext() local
215 if (size != sizeof(*msa)) in restore_msa_extcontext()
[all …]
Dgenex.S572 BUILD_HANDLER msa msa sti silent /* #21 */
Dtraps.c1274 static int enable_restore_fp_context(int msa) in enable_restore_fp_context() argument
1285 if (msa && !err) { in enable_restore_fp_context()
1333 if (!msa && !thread_msa_context_live()) in enable_restore_fp_context()
1395 static int enable_restore_fp_context(int msa) in enable_restore_fp_context() argument
/linux-6.1.9/arch/mips/include/asm/
Dasmmacro.h247 .set msa
256 .set msa
265 .set msa
274 .set msa
283 .set msa
292 .set msa
301 .set msa
310 .set msa
319 .set msa
328 .set msa
[all …]
/linux-6.1.9/drivers/net/wireless/ath/ath10k/
Dsnoc.c1438 hdr->start = cpu_to_le32((unsigned long)ar->msa.vaddr); in ath10k_msa_dump_memory()
1439 hdr->length = cpu_to_le32(ar->msa.mem_size); in ath10k_msa_dump_memory()
1441 if (current_region->len < ar->msa.mem_size) { in ath10k_msa_dump_memory()
1442 memcpy(buf, ar->msa.vaddr, current_region->len); in ath10k_msa_dump_memory()
1444 current_region->len, ar->msa.mem_size); in ath10k_msa_dump_memory()
1446 memcpy(buf, ar->msa.vaddr, ar->msa.mem_size); in ath10k_msa_dump_memory()
1558 ar->msa.paddr = r.start; in ath10k_setup_msa_resources()
1559 ar->msa.mem_size = resource_size(&r); in ath10k_setup_msa_resources()
1560 ar->msa.vaddr = devm_memremap(dev, ar->msa.paddr, in ath10k_setup_msa_resources()
1561 ar->msa.mem_size, in ath10k_setup_msa_resources()
[all …]
Dqmi.c125 req.msa_addr = ar->msa.paddr; in ath10k_qmi_msa_mem_info_send_sync_msg()
126 req.size = ar->msa.mem_size; in ath10k_qmi_msa_mem_info_send_sync_msg()
160 max_mapped_addr = ar->msa.paddr + ar->msa.mem_size; in ath10k_qmi_msa_mem_info_send_sync_msg()
163 if (resp.mem_region_info[i].size > ar->msa.mem_size || in ath10k_qmi_msa_mem_info_send_sync_msg()
165 resp.mem_region_info[i].region_addr < ar->msa.paddr || in ath10k_qmi_msa_mem_info_send_sync_msg()
Dcore.h1019 } msa; member
/linux-6.1.9/Documentation/devicetree/bindings/net/wireless/
Dqcom,ath10k.txt73 Definition: reference to the reserved-memory for the msa region
92 - qcom,msa-fixed-perm: Boolean context flag to disable SCM call for statically
93 mapped msa region.
211 qcom,msa-fixed-perm;
/linux-6.1.9/arch/mips/kvm/
DMakefile9 kvm-$(CONFIG_CPU_HAS_MSA) += msa.o
/linux-6.1.9/drivers/s390/cio/
Dchsc.h196 u64 msa; member
/linux-6.1.9/arch/mips/
DMakefile216 toolchain-msa := $(call cc-option-yn,$(mips-cflags) -mhard-float -mfp64 -Wa$(comma)-mmsa)
217 cflags-$(toolchain-msa) += -DTOOLCHAIN_SUPPORTS_MSA
/linux-6.1.9/arch/arm64/boot/dts/qcom/
Dsdm630.dtsi346 wlan_msa_guard: wlan-msa-guard@85600000 {
351 wlan_msa_mem: wlan-msa-mem@85700000 {
Dsm6350.dtsi1546 qcom,msa-fixed-perm;
Dsc7180.dtsi3564 qcom,msa-fixed-perm;
Dsdm845.dtsi155 wlan_msa_mem: wlan-msa@8df00000 {
/linux-6.1.9/drivers/dma/
Dimx-sdma.c346 u32 msa; member